- The plan needs to comprise the concept of diversity and embraces acceptance and respect. It means understanding that each individual is unique, and recognising and accepting individual similarities and differences. These can be along the lines of race, ethnicity, gender, sexual orientation, socio-economic status, age, physical and mental abilities, religious beliefs, political beliefs, or other ideologies. It is the exploration of these differences in a safe, positive, and nurturing environment. It is about understanding each other and moving beyond mere tolerance to embracing and celebrating the rich dimensions of diversity contained within each individual.
